面向对象的软件开发技术是当今计算机技术发展的重要成果和趋势之一。C#是完全面向对象的程序设计语言。封装性、继承性和多态性是面向对象的特点。2020/2/191C#:桑塔纳对象特征::载人抽象实例化类:汽车属性:颜色型号马力生产厂家服务:运输数据值执行的操作类与对象的关系示例{:是一种抽象的数据类型,它是所有具有一定共性的对象的抽象。本质上可以认为是对对象的描述,是创建对象的“模板”。类的某一个对象则被称为是类的一个实例,是类的实例化结果。对象类实例化抽象课堂讨论先有对象还是先有类?-应该先定义类才可以从类的定义声明对象。:[类修饰符]class类名[:基类类名]{类体}关键字合法的标识符字段(成员变量)(成员变量)与普通变量的声明格式相同。在类体中,字段声明的位置没有特殊要求****惯上将字段声明在类体中的最前面,以便于阅读。,包含姓名和年龄两项学生信息,并能输出。classStudent{//字段声明publicstringstrName;publicintnAge;//方法publicvoidpri(){("姓名为:{0},年龄为{1}",strName,nAge);}}添加构造方法,完成字段初始化例7-?与你的源代码文件在一块,同一个命名空间(namespace)下。C#允许在一个类中嵌套另一个类的定义。[建议]。-创建类的对象在C#中,我们使用new运算符来创建类的对象。定义Student类的对象Studentstu=newStudent();类名对象名=new类名();实例化对象引用对象成员变量的语法形式为:(成员方法);例如:;;();访问对象成员
高等教育C面向对象程序设计 来自淘豆网www.taodocs.com转载请标明出处.